On the bottom of the page it states:
In dusty conditions , change oil every 100 miles. This is because the pre 42 engine sucked in the dust through the (earlier open and later horse hair) breather (oil filler cap) these were then changed to the oil bath breather which would have greatly reduced the dust and engine wear.
